St Marylebone by-election, 1932
From Infogalactic: the planetary knowledge core
The St Marylebone by-election of 1932 was held on 28 April 1932. The by-election was held due to the succession to the peerage of the incumbent Conservative MP, James Rennell Rodd. It was won by the Conservative candidate Alec Cunningham-Reid.[1]
